Nintex: The Powerhouse of Workflow Automation
Nintex, on the other hand, is like the Swiss Army knife of workflow automation. If you’re yearning for a solution that’s more about reducing manual effort, this might be your haven. Here’s where it shines:
- Automation: For businesses looking to automate intricate workflows, Nintex offers robust solutions that take the drudgery out of routine tasks.
- Integration: It plays well with others, seamlessly integrating with a myriad of systems that are already in your arsenal.
- Forms and Mobile Solutions: Nintex isn’t just for the desktop-bound. It extends its power to mobile workforces, making processes accessible from anywhere. 📱
When you harness the power of Nintex, the aim is clear: cut the time spent on repetitive tasks and double down on the business issues that truly demand your attention.

Nintex’s Claim to Fame
Nintex doesn't just show up at the party. It arrives with workflow automation mastery, aimed at overhauling how your team tackles daily operations:
- Form Creation and Automation: Nintex forms are a savior in eliminating redundancies. Automate processes that drain time and see your efficiency soar. 🚀
- Process Mapping: Better visualization leads to better decisions. Nintex lets you map out processes as intuitive diagrams, putting you miles ahead in the workflow game.
- Rich Integrations: That’s right; Nintex charms its way into various applications, seamlessly meshing with your existing tech stack.
